Virtual Reality:

Imagine being able to tour upcoming or newly launched properties without stepping out of your home. This is what virtual reality (VR) technology is bringing to the real estate market. Builders are utilizing VR to create immersive property tours, allowing potential buyers and investors to explore every nook and cranny of a property from the comfort of their couch. This technology not only saves time but also offers a glimpse of how the property looks inside and out. 

Smart Homes: 

In a city where every square foot matters, builders are making the most of available space by incorporating smart home technology. From lighting and temperature control to security and entertainment systems, smart homes offer residents unparalleled convenience and connectivity. Builders are now collaborating with tech companies to create homes that can be controlled with a smartphone, allowing residents to manage their living spaces remotely and efficiently. Artificial Intelligence: 

AI is no longer a concept confined to science fiction; it's actively shaping the way builders design and construct properties in Mumbai. With AI-powered tools, builders can analyze data to make informed decisions regarding site selection, materials, and design. This data-driven approach not only ensures cost efficiency but also minimizes risks associated with construction.

Additionally, AI algorithms are being used to predict market trends, helping builders anticipate shifts in demand and adjust their projects based on the evolving needs of the market.

Online Platforms and Apps: 

Builders are not only using technology to enhance the physical aspects of real estate but also to streamline the buying and selling process. Online platforms and mobile apps allow potential buyers to browse the properties, schedule visits, etc. Moreover, these platforms provide transparency by offering real-time updates on property availability, prices, and amenities.

Energy Efficiency and Sustainability:

Some builders are aware of their role in preserving the environment and prioritize sustainability in construction. There are several developers who have designed energy-efficient buildings that align with global environmental standards. Moreover, some are employing sensors and automation systems to optimize energy usage, monitor water consumption, and manage waste disposal. Such technologies will also help reduce utility costs for residents, making sustainable living a viable and attractive option.
